What Is a Backpack Gas Blower and How Does It Work?

A backpack gas blower is a portable device designed to clear debris, such as leaves and grass clippings, using a powerful engine that generates a high-velocity air stream. This equipment is worn on the back, allowing for mobility and ease of use in outdoor environments.

The American National Standards Institute (ANSI) defines a backpack blower as a “hand-held or walk-behind power tool that uses an engine-driven fan to propel air out of a nozzle for moving debris.”

Backpack gas blowers operate by drawing air into the machine and accelerating it through a fan, creating a strong wind. Users can control the airflow direction through a handheld nozzle. These devices are popular for their efficiency compared to handheld blowers.

What Key Features Should You Consider When Choosing a Backpack Gas Blower?

When choosing a backpack gas blower, consider the following key features:

  1. Engine power
  2. Weight and comfort
  3. Air output and speed
  4. Noise level
  5. Fuel efficiency
  6. Ease of use and maintenance
  7. Brand reputation and warranty

The features listed above can help you assess which backpack gas blower best suits your needs and preferences.

  1. Engine Power: Engine power in a backpack gas blower is crucial for determining efficiency and performance. Higher horsepower typically means greater airflow and faster debris clearing. For example, a blower with 50cc engine power is generally more effective in heavy-duty applications compared to a 25cc blower. According to a study by Consumer Reports (2021), higher engine power correlates with faster work completion times.

  2. Weight and Comfort: Weight and comfort impact how long you can use the blower without fatigue. A lighter blower is often easier to maneuver. Look for padded shoulder straps and adjustable harness systems. A model that weighs around 20 pounds can be handled comfortably by most users for extended periods.

  3. Air Output and Speed: Air output, measured in cubic feet per minute (CFM), signifies how much air the blower moves. Higher CFM ratings assist in removing heavier debris. The speed of airflow, measured in miles per hour (MPH), gives you insight into effectiveness. Blowers with 500 CFM and 200 MPH are suitable for most residential tasks according to information from the American National Standards Institute (ANSI).

  4. Noise Level: Noise is an essential factor in choosing a blower due to community regulations and personal preference. Look for models that operate at or below 65 decibels for compliance with typical residential noise ordinances. The EPA has guidelines recommending that gas-powered equipment should not exceed 70 decibels to reduce noise pollution.

  5. Fuel Efficiency: Fuel efficiency indicates how much fuel the blower consumes relative to its performance. Opt for models that offer a mix of power and lower emissions. Two-stroke engines often use more fuel than four-stroke engines. For instance, four-stroke engines generally produce fewer emissions and offer better fuel efficiency, making them an environmentally friendly option.

  6. Ease of Use and Maintenance: Features that promote ease of use include easy-start mechanisms, intuitive controls, and accessible air filters. Regular maintenance requirements also matter; models with tool-less access for filter cleaning and fuel refilling provide convenience. According to a guide by Outdoor Power Equipment Institute (OPEI), proper maintenance can extend the lifespan of your equipment significantly.

  7. Brand Reputation and Warranty: A reliable brand often signifies quality and customer support. Look for manufacturers with positive reviews and strong warranties covering parts and labor. For example, brands like Stihl and Husqvarna have long-standing reputations and typically offer warranties ranging from one to five years, showcasing their commitment to quality.

How Does Engine Power Influence the Performance of a Backpack Gas Blower?

Engine power significantly influences the performance of a backpack gas blower. Higher engine power results in increased airflow and greater velocity. This allows the blower to move heavier debris more efficiently. A powerful engine can also enhance the blower’s ability to operate for longer periods without overheating.

When a blower has more engine power, it can produce higher air pressure. This pressure helps clear thick layers of leaves and dirt quickly. Additionally, powerful engines often feature larger capacity fuel tanks. This means longer operational time before needing to refuel.

Effective air distribution depends on engine performance. A well-powered blower maintains steady air output, improving overall maneuverability. Users can direct debris without needing to start and stop frequently.

In contrast, a lower-powered engine may struggle with tough tasks. It might produce weaker airflow and slower speed. This can lead to longer working times and increased effort from the user. Hence, selecting the right engine power is crucial for achieving optimal performance in a backpack gas blower.

Why Are Weight and Comfort Crucial in Selecting a Backpack Gas Blower?

Weight and comfort are crucial factors when selecting a backpack gas blower. A lightweight blower reduces fatigue during extended use. Comfort affects user experience and efficiency while operating the equipment.

As defined by the American Society of Agricultural and Biological Engineers (ASABE), weight refers to the force exerted by gravity on an object, while comfort relates to the user’s ability to operate the equipment without strain or discomfort. Research indicates that good ergonomic design enhances user performance and reduces the risk of injury.

The significance of weight and comfort primarily arises from user endurance and effectiveness. When a blower is too heavy, it can lead to physical strain, particularly in the back and shoulders. This strain can cause exhaustion and distract from the task at hand. A comfortable fit allows the user to maintain control and perform tasks over longer periods without unnecessary fatigue.

Ergonomics plays a key role in this selection process. Ergonomics is the science of designing equipment and environments to optimize human well-being and overall system performance. In backpack gas blowers, ergonomically designed straps, weight distribution, and handle positions help prevent strain. For instance, if a blower weighs 25 pounds but distributes weight evenly, the user experiences less fatigue compared to a 15-pound blower with poor weight distribution.

Certain conditions, such as prolonged usage, uneven terrain, or working in difficult positions, exacerbate the challenges related to weight and comfort. For example, operators using a heavy blower while navigating hilly landscapes may find themselves quickly fatigued. Conversely, a lightweight, well-balanced blower allows for better maneuverability and sustained productivity, even in demanding conditions.
